Responsibilities

As a Cybersecurity Engineer with AMERICAN SYSTEMS you will have an opportunity to do the following:

  • Join us at an exciting time as we introduce next-generation technologies
  • Be part of a group that provides game-changing capabilities to the nation
  • Assist System Security Engineering (SSE) Managers with navigating DoD and DoN CS processes to include Committee on National Security Systems Instruction (CNSSI) 1253 and Joint Special Access Program Implementation Guide (JSIG) Risk Management Framework (RMF) implementations upon request
  • Provide dedicated Assessment and Authorization (A&A) support services as defined in the DoD/DoN Risk Management Framework (RMF)
  • Assist the customer in transitioning system security documentation from the existing JAFAN 6/3 terminology to the Risk Management Framework (RMF) terminology
  • Conduct in-depth technical reviews of Assessment and Authorization (A&A) documentation from system integrators/developers supporting the PO to achieve successful Authorizing Official (AO) decisions in support of Authority to Operate (ATO) milestones IAW JSIG and NIST SP 800-137 Continuous Monitoring Requirements
  • Conduct PO security control assessments of System Integrator/developer submitted A&A documentation to ensure compliance with RMF requirements
  • Generate and submit PO A&A documentation required for submission of PO DoN Security Authorization (SA) packages
  • Create/review the System Security Plans (SSP), Security Control Traceability Matrix (SCTM), Plan of Action and Milestone (POA&M), OPSEC Plans, Cybersecurity Test Plan/Reports, IA Vulnerability Management Plans, and Risk Management Plans to ensure documentation/artifacts are in compliance with RMF requirements
  • Ensure that all PO cybersecurity-related documentation is current and accessible to properly authorized individuals; maintain the A&A package repository
  • Implement/monitor Program Office (PO) continuous monitoring Plans/strategies to ensure compliance with DoN Cybersecurity policy.
  • Ensure site compliance with cybersecurity inspections, assessments and reviews are synchronized and coordinated with affected parties and stakeholders as appropriate, and review/archive the documented results in support of Program level continuous monitoring Plans
  • Prepare and update of the IA/CS components of various milestone decision support documents such as but not limited to the Systems Engineering Plans (SEP), Test and Evaluation Management Plans (TEMP) and Test and Evaluation Strategies (TES), and Integrated Logistic Support Plans (ILSP)

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ree and 10 years of relevant experience in Cybersecurity, Anti-Tamper and Information Assurance
  • IAM or IAT DoD 8570.01 (Information Assurance Workforce Improvement Program)//DoD 8140 (Cyberspace Workforce 8410 level III certified
  • Secret Clearance
  • Experience with RMF and/or National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) 800-53
  • Experience as an ISSM or performing the role of an ISSM in an RMF environment
  • Experience supporting ACAT programs
